McKinleyville Family Resource Center - 1615 Heartwood Drive, McKinleyville McKinleyvilleFamily Resource Center PANTRY HOURS OF OPERATIONMonday Thursday 1000am300pmClosed for lunch daily 1200pm100pmClosed Friday Programs Services We offer an array of programs and services that support enrich and sustain healthy community life. These include a food pantry Humboldt Income Program Youth Workforce Development Community Outreach and more. Our Vision We envision a community in which citizens business and government combine to facilitate solutions to the changing needs of the community to the end that all members live healthy fulfilled lives in a fully integrated and welcoming environment.
